Marriage on in Sint-Jans-Molenbeek (Belgium)

Father of groom

Albert Bürgij, residing in Anderlecht, relieur by profession, consentant par acte reçu le six mai dernier.

Mother of groom

Marie Thérèse Dedemaecker, residing in Anderlecht, sans profession by profession

Groom

Gustave Bürgij, born on July 25, 1872 in Anderlecht (Belgium), residing in Anderlecht, typographe by profession, né d'un père français.

Bride

Marie Victorine Devisch, born on October 1, 1882 in Lembeek (Belgium), residing in Molenbeek-Saint-Jean, sans profession by profession

Father of bride

Charles Louis Devisch, residing in Lembeek, journalier by profession, consentant par acte reçu le premier mai dernier.

Mother of bride

Marie Anne Vandenwyngaert, residing in Lembeek, sans profession by profession

Witnesses


Source citation

State Archives of Belgium (Brussels) in Leuven (Belgium), Civil registration marriages
Burgerlijke stand Brussel, Leuven, June 13, 1903, record number 288
